2. Transportation Infrastructure
Effective distribution networks in California rely heavily on robust transportation infrastructure. Accessibility to various transportation modes significantly influences the efficiency and reach of these networks. Analyzing the existing infrastructure and its capacity is crucial for optimizing supply chain operations and ensuring timely delivery of goods.
-
Highway Network
California’s extensive highway system plays a vital role in connecting distribution centers to various markets across the state. Proximity to major interstates and highways facilitates efficient trucking operations, enabling rapid transportation of goods. However, traffic congestion in densely populated areas can present challenges. Analyzing traffic patterns and utilizing route optimization software are crucial for mitigating delays and maintaining predictable delivery schedules. For example, distribution centers located near the I-5 or I-10 corridors benefit from convenient access to major transportation arteries, facilitating statewide reach.
-
Seaports
California’s major seaports, including the Ports of Los Angeles and Long Beach, handle a substantial volume of international trade. Distribution centers strategically located near these ports can efficiently receive imported goods and facilitate their distribution throughout the state and beyond. Efficient port operations and intermodal connectivity are critical for minimizing delays and ensuring smooth cargo flow. Businesses involved in global trade benefit significantly from proximity to these ports, streamlining import and export processes.
-
Railways
Rail transport offers a cost-effective solution for moving large quantities of goods over long distances. Integrating rail lines into the distribution network can reduce transportation costs and lower the environmental impact. However, rail transport can be less flexible than trucking, requiring careful planning and coordination. Distribution centers with access to rail yards can leverage this mode for bulk shipments and long-haul transportation within California and across the country.
-
Airports
Airfreight plays a crucial role in the rapid delivery of time-sensitive goods. Distribution centers located near major airports, such as LAX or SFO, can leverage air transport for expedited shipping, particularly for high-value or perishable items. While airfreight is generally more expensive than other modes, it provides a significant advantage for businesses requiring speed and reliability. This proximity allows companies to efficiently manage time-critical deliveries and cater to demanding supply chain requirements.
The interconnected nature of these transportation modes highlights the importance of a well-planned and integrated approach. Distribution centers benefit significantly from locations offering access to multiple transportation options, allowing for flexibility and adaptability in response to changing market demands and logistical needs. Careful consideration of transportation infrastructure is essential for optimizing distribution network efficiency and ensuring seamless product flow throughout California’s diverse and expansive market.

6. Technology Integration
Technology integration plays a crucial role in optimizing distribution center operations within California’s competitive logistics landscape. Modern supply chains rely heavily on sophisticated technologies to enhance efficiency, improve visibility, and reduce operational costs. Integrating these technologies effectively is essential for managing complex inventory flows, meeting stringent delivery deadlines, and adapting to dynamic market demands within the state.
-
Warehouse Management Systems (WMS)
WMS software forms the backbone of distribution center operations, managing inventory tracking, order fulfillment, and labor allocation. Real-time visibility into inventory levels enables efficient stock replenishment and minimizes storage costs. Integrated with automated picking and sorting systems, WMS streamlines order processing, reducing errors and accelerating fulfillment times. For example, a WMS can optimize storage locations based on product velocity, minimizing travel time for picking operations within a large distribution center. This efficiency is crucial in high-volume facilities serving California’s major metropolitan areas.
-
Transportation Management Systems (TMS)
TMS platforms optimize transportation routes, manage carrier relationships, and track shipments in real-time. Integrating TMS with WMS enables seamless coordination between warehousing and transportation operations. Route optimization algorithms minimize transportation costs by considering factors like traffic conditions, fuel prices, and delivery windows. Real-time tracking provides visibility into shipment status, allowing for proactive communication with customers and efficient management of delivery exceptions. In California’s extensive highway network, TMS plays a vital role in navigating traffic congestion and ensuring timely delivery to dispersed markets.
-
Automation and Robotics
Automated systems, including robotic picking arms, automated guided vehicles (AGVs), and automated storage and retrieval systems (AS/RS), are increasingly prevalent in modern distribution centers. These technologies enhance efficiency by automating repetitive tasks, reducing labor costs, and minimizing human error. Automated systems also improve safety by reducing workplace accidents. For example, in a high-volume e-commerce fulfillment center, robotic picking arms can significantly accelerate order processing, enabling faster delivery to customers throughout California.
-
Data Analytics and Predictive Modeling
Data analytics tools provide valuable insights into distribution center performance, identifying areas for improvement and supporting data-driven decision-making. Predictive modeling, using historical data and machine learning algorithms, can forecast demand fluctuations, optimize inventory levels, and anticipate potential supply chain disruptions. This proactive approach enhances operational efficiency, minimizes costs, and improves responsiveness to changing market conditions. In California’s dynamic market, data analytics plays a crucial role in adapting to seasonal demand peaks and mitigating the impact of supply chain variability.
Integrating these technologies creates a synergistic effect, optimizing distribution center operations and enhancing competitiveness within California’s demanding market. The seamless flow of information between systems improves visibility, reduces operational costs, and enhances responsiveness to customer demands. These technological advancements are essential for meeting the challenges and capitalizing on the opportunities presented by California’s complex and dynamic logistics landscape.
7. Regulatory Compliance
Regulatory compliance forms a critical component of operating distribution centers in California. Stringent state and local regulations govern various aspects of warehousing and logistics, including environmental protection, worker safety, and transportation. Non-compliance can result in significant penalties, operational disruptions, and reputational damage. Understanding and adhering to these regulations is essential for maintaining smooth operations and ensuring long-term sustainability.
California’s environmental regulations address issues such as air quality, waste management, and hazardous materials handling. Distribution centers must comply with emissions standards for vehicles and equipment, implement recycling programs, and adhere to strict protocols for handling and disposing of hazardous waste. For instance, regulations mandate the use of low-emission trucks and equipment in certain areas to minimize air pollution. Worker safety regulations, enforced by Cal/OSHA, cover areas such as warehouse safety protocols, equipment operation standards, and employee training requirements. Distribution centers must maintain safe working environments, provide appropriate safety training, and comply with regulations regarding equipment maintenance and operation. Failure to comply can lead to hefty fines and potential legal action. Transportation regulations govern vehicle weight limits, driver hours of service, and cargo securement procedures. Distribution centers relying on trucking operations must adhere to these regulations to ensure safe and efficient transportation of goods. Non-compliance can result in penalties and delays in deliveries. For example, regulations require trucks to meet specific weight limits to protect road infrastructure and ensure public safety.
Successfully navigating California’s complex regulatory landscape requires proactive engagement with relevant agencies, thorough understanding of applicable regulations, and implementation of robust compliance programs. Investing in compliance expertise, implementing regular audits, and maintaining accurate documentation demonstrate commitment to responsible business practices. Ultimately, regulatory compliance not only mitigates legal and financial risks but also contributes to a positive brand image, builds trust with stakeholders, and supports the long-term sustainability of distribution operations in California.
